The ADLAS 2026 workshop was the sixth one in a long-standing series of international meetings held in Czechia every ten years since 1976. The workshop was convened by J. Plomerová (IG CAS, Prague), and co-convened by Shun-ichiro Karato (Yale University, New Haven, USA), Claudia Piromallo and Silvia Pondrelli (INGV, Roma and Bologna, Italy). The meeting ultimately hosted 50 scientists from 14 countries: Italy (8), Germany (6), UK (7), Czechia (5), USA (4), Spain (3), Australia (2), Canada (2), China (2), France (2), Hungary (2), Norway (2), Poland (2), Croatia (1). Among the participants were 20 Early Career Researchers (ECRs) from Italy, Germany, UK, Hungary, Croatia, Poland and China, who actively presented and discussed their research in the workshop. Thanks to supports from the ORFEUS Community Project Support Grant and the International Lithosphere Programme (ILP), the workshop registration fee could be reduced significantly for 13 ECR participants.

The scientific program included 31 oral presentations and 21 posters. The majority of the contributions concentrated prevailingly on large-scale seismic anisotropy in the Earth crust and mantle, both in the continental and oceanic lithospheres, sub-lithospheric upper mantle, and on the Earth discontinuities. Several presentations also introduced significant methodological advances and their applications to different tectonic regions.

The program included 7 keynote lectures delivered by leading specialists in the field – B. Romanowicz, A. Ferreira, M. Faccenda, J. Park, B. VanderBeek, C. Rychert and C. Eakin. These keynotes covered major scientific themes and stimulated extensive discussions throughout the workshop. Friendly discussions of both senior scientists and ECRs following oral presentations and during the poster sessions contributed to the exceptionally collegial and productive atmosphere of the meeting.

In addition to four daily oral sessions and posters sessions, the scientific program included two evening sessions. The first one was dedicated to ECRs and the second evening session focused on the AtlanticArray project in preparation. Scientific program and abstracts of the ADLAS 2026 workshop are freely available at https://www.ig.cas.cz/en/international-workshop-seismic-anisotropy-heterogeneity-and-dynamics-of-the-lithosphere-asthenosphere-system/.

Financial supports from ORFEUS Community Project Support Grant, the ILP-supported workshop, and from the Task Force 4 CoLiBrI – Continental Lithosphere Broadscale Investigation of the International Lithosphere Programme are greatly appreciated.
